Why take this tour?

Discover the typical wines for the famous Valpolicella region and taste five of them! You'll have the chance to enjoy the Amarone and Prosecco and to visit the beautiful villa Giona. You'll walk in its vineyards and learn how the Italian wines are produced! A tasting of the best selection of wines produced by Tenute Salvaterra will follow (Prosecco, Valpolicella Classico, Valpolicella Classico Ripasso, Lazzarone and Amarone).
